There are a set of lectures on Archive.org Also a great asset is the learner.org sites video series "The Western Tradition" in addition if you haven't signed up for instantcert the exam specific section is awesome for hints and study guides as well as the flashcards and audio (although it is a bit robotic)

reading the West Civ books was dry for me too but with the rest combined along with going through the questions in the back of the REA with the corresponding answer i did well.
